Jimmy Choo
Jimmy Choo is a British luxury fashion house founded in 1996 by Jimmy Choo and Tamara Mellon in London. The brand is owned by Capri Holdings, which acquired it in 2017 for approximately 1.2 billion USD. Jimmy Choo is known primarily for its luxury women's footwear, and has expanded into handbags, accessories, fragrances, and men's shoes.
